I didn't have any options for broadband in my city, so I am stuck with this ISP, they work mainly where there are no other options for broadband. I got a 600kbps connection and their price (including public IP) is absurd, $150,00 a month. (~R$300,00). The other available broadband here is Velox. Their price is about $75,00 for a 1mbps connection, I'd pick them if I could, but they use adsl and I'm too far away from them.

Now, what pisses me off about Taho is their QoS or priority system for ports. Excluding 80 and a few others, every external port is hindered to a point they aren't usable at all. The RTT on those ports range from 1500ms to complete stall/reconnect while using an icmp ping, I get around 215-300ms with a 1500 packet (including headers, obviously). So basically, I'm lucky if I get past 0,5Kb/s on any uncommon port. Meaning, no streaming radio, no gaming, no webcam, no voip, no p2p, no file transfer, nothing but stupid browsing which I rarely do anyway. This priority system is also -not- mentioned in their contract, I will make sure to sue them as soon as I can get rid of them.
